一、RS-232、RS-422与RS-485的简略介绍
RS-232、RS-422与RS-485都是串行数据接口规范,开始都是由电子工业协会(EIA)拟定并发布的。RS-232在1962年发布,命名为EIA-232-E,作为工业规范,以确保不同厂家产品之间的兼容。其传送间隔最大约为15米,最高速率为20kb/s,而且RS-232是为点对点(即只用一对收、发设备)通讯而规划的。所以,RS232只适合于本地通讯运用。
RS-422由RS-232开展而来,它是为补偿RS-232之缺乏而提出的。为改善RS-232通讯间隔短、速率低的缺陷,RS-422界说了一种平衡通讯接口,将传输速率提高到10Mb/s,传输间隔延长到1200米(速率低于100kb/s时),并答应在一条平衡总线上衔接最多10个接纳器。RS-422是一种单机发送、多机接纳的单向、平衡传输规范,被命名为TIA/EIA-422-A规范。为扩展运用规模,EIA又于1983年在RS-422基础上拟定了RS-485规范,增加了多点、双向通讯才能,即答应多个发送器衔接到同一条总线上,一起增加了发送器的驱动才能和抵触维护特性,扩展了总线共模规模,后命名为TIA/EIA-485-A规范。因为EIA提出的主张规范都是以RS作为前缀,所以在通讯工业范畴,依然习气将上述规范以RS作前缀称谓。RS-232、RS-422与RS-485规范只对接口的电气特性做出规则,而不触及接插件、电缆或协议,在此基础上用户能够树立自己的高层通讯协议。
二、克己RS232-485转化器
电路图:
RS232-485转化器首要包含了电源、232电平转化、485电路三部分。本电路的232电平转化电路采用了NIH232或许也能够直接运用MAX232集成电路,485电路采用了MAX485%&&&&&%。为了运用方便,电源部分规划成无源方法,整个电路的供电直接从PC机的RS232接口中的DTR(4脚)和RTS(7脚)盗取。PC串口每根线能够供应大约9mA的电流,因而两根线供应的电流满足供应这个电路运用了。经试验,本电路只运用其间一条线也能够正常作业。运用本电路需注意PC程序有必要使串口的DTR和RTS输出高电平,经过D3稳压后得到VCC,经过实践测验,VCC电压大约在4.7V左右。因而,电路中要说D3起的作用是稳压还不如说是限压功用。电子元件邮购
MAX485是经过两个引脚RE(2脚)和DE(3脚)来操控数据的输入和输出。当RE为低电平常,MAX485数据输入有用;当DE为高电平常,MAX485数据输出有用。在半双工运用中,一般能够将这两个脚直接相连,然后由PC或许单片机输出的凹凸电平就能够让MAX485在接纳和发送状况之间转化了。因为本电路DTR和RTS都用于了电路供电,因而运用TX线和HIN232的别的一个通道及Q1来操控MAX485的状况切换。平常NIH232的9脚输出高电平,经Q1倒相后,使MAX485的RE和DE为低电平而处于数据接纳状况。当PC机发送数据时,NIH232的9脚输出低电平,经Q1倒相后,使MAX485的RE和DE为高电平而处于数据发送状况。